Как внедрить взвешенный процентиль с MySQL - PullRequest
1 голос
/ 06 июня 2011

У меня есть большой набор данных, который включает цены, по которым конкретный продукт продается в разных магазинах.Мне нужно найти самую низкую и самую высокую цену, по которой происходили 80% продаж.например, со следующими данными самое низкое будет 1,1, а самое высокое 1,9:

price   sales
-----   -----
1       2
1.1     2
1.2     2
1.4     3
1.5     4
1.6     2
1.7     2
1.9     1
2.2     1
2.5     1

Кто-нибудь может предложить способ сделать это?

1 Ответ

1 голос
/ 06 июня 2011

MySQL - это база данных, плохо подходящая для численных методов. R является одним из многих программируемых статистических пакетов, которые могут получать данные из баз данных, таких как MySQL.

Пакет RODBC , вероятно, является хорошей отправной точкой.

...